task-30: getTaskPollBackoffMs 递增序列
getTaskPollBackoffMs 签名改为 attempt 可选(省略视为 0,向后兼容), 序列 500×factor^attempt、封顶 maxMs 行为由任务 29 的 factor 配置驱动。 新增 8 个测试:attempt0/1/2 值、序列单调、封顶、省略参数默认、 负 attempt 当 0、自定义 factor。
